The best area to stay in Asco, Catalonia, Spain, is within the village centre, particularly around Plaça de la Vila and the surrounding streets.This area is the heart of Asco, offering a traditional village experience. It's characterised by narrow, winding streets, historic stone buildings, and a relaxed pace of life. Plaça de la Vila is the main square, often a focal point for local activities and where you'll find the town hall and a few local eateries. The Parish Church of Sant Joan Baptista, with its prominent bell tower, is another key landmark within easy walking distance.Couples looking for a quiet escape will appreciate the village centre. It provides a genuine taste of rural Catalan life, with opportunities for gentle strolls through historic streets and enjoying local cuisine in a relaxed setting. The nearby Ebro River offers scenic views and chances for riverside walks.For those interested in local history and culture, staying in the village centre offers direct access to Asco's heritage.
